How can one start living a sober life?

Starting a sober life begins with a commitment to personal change and setting clear, measurable goals. This could include regular attendance at 12-step meetings, engaging in therapy sessions, and focusing on physical health through a balanced diet and regular exercise. These practices not only foster physical well-being but also help reduce cravings and prevent potential relapses.

Surrounding yourself with supportive individuals in sober environments is crucial. Avoiding triggers—both emotional and environmental—is equally important. Engaging in new, meaningful activities can shift focus away from past habits. Setting personal boundaries with unsupportive friends or family can further create a healthier lifestyle.

Additionally, embracing your recovery community is a key step. Joining support groups, such as Alcoholics Anonymous, provides a network of understanding individuals who can offer encouragement and accountability. Seeking professional help gives access to valuable resources tailored to maintain sobriety long-term, making the recovery journey less daunting.

The Three P's of Sobriety: Keys to Success

Master the Three P's: Patience, Persistence, Perseverance!

What are the 3 P's of sobriety?

The three P’s of sobriety are patience, persistence, and perseverance. Each quality plays a crucial role in the recovery process.

  • Patience is vital, as recovery is a non-linear journey often accompanied by setbacks. Accepting this reality allows individuals to approach challenges without becoming discouraged.
  • Persistence reflects an unwavering dedication to face challenges head-on. Maintaining commitment to sobriety requires continual effort, even when faced with obstacles.
  • Perseverance embodies the resilience necessary to keep moving forward toward recovery goals. It ensures individuals remain focused and motivated, particularly during tough times.

Strategies for overcoming relapse

To effectively combat relapse, individuals can implement several practical strategies:

  • Identify triggers: Understanding both internal (emotions, stress) and external (people, locations) triggers helps in avoiding situations that could lead to a relapse.
  • Develop coping mechanisms: Healthy coping strategies, such as regular exercise, mindfulness, and engaging in hobbies, can reduce cravings and provide emotional stability.
  • Maintain a structured schedule: Establishing a daily routine minimizes free time for temptations and fosters accountability.
  • Seek support: Regular participation in support groups like Alcoholics Anonymous (AA) can create a sense of community and accountability that reinforces commitment to sobriety.

By embodying the three P’s and employing effective strategies, individuals can increase their chances of success in maintaining sobriety.

Navigating the Most Challenging Stage of Sobriety

What is the hardest stage of sobriety?

The first 90 days of sobriety are often recognized as the most challenging phase. During this period, individuals face a high risk of relapse, compounded by withdrawal symptoms that can vary from physical pain to psychological distress.

  • Days 1-30:

    • Physical pain and cravings intensify.
    • Psychological challenges can lead to feelings of doubt and anxiety.
    • Professional support during detox is crucial to help individuals navigate early obstacles.
  • Days 30-90:

    • Establishing a structured daily routine is essential.
    • Intensive outpatient programs can provide ongoing support.
    • Focusing on personal health and new positive habits helps reinforce commitment.

Physical, Mental, and Emotional Benefits of Sobriety

Living a sober life can lead to a plethora of benefits that enrich overall well-being. Physically, sobriety promotes better sleep patterns, enhances energy levels, and reduces the risk of serious health issues, such as liver disease, certain cancers, and cardiovascular problems. Individuals often experience improved skin, brighter eyes, and a healthier appearance as their bodies heal from the damages of substance use.

Mentally, choosing sobriety significantly boosts cognitive function, enhancing focus and memory. Enhanced decision-making capabilities help individuals avoid impulsive actions commonly associated with intoxication. Emotionally, sobriety fosters stability, reducing mood swings and fostering a more balanced emotional state. This stability contributes to the development of stronger relationships, allowing for authentic connections free from the influence of substances.

Longer Life Expectancy

Achieving sobriety not only improves quality of life but can also greatly extend longevity. The CDC reports that chronic alcohol use can shorten life expectancy by up to 30 years. By abstaining from substances, individuals not only experience better health but also increase their chances of living a longer, healthier life. Role of Support Groups Like AA and NA

Support groups, such as Alcoholics Anonymous (AA) and Narcotics Anonymous (NA), play a pivotal role in the recovery journey. These peer-led organizations offer a space for individuals struggling with addiction to connect, share experiences, and support one another. Participating in these meetings fosters accountability, encouraging members to remain committed to sobriety. Studies suggest that engagement in 12-step groups significantly predicts positive recovery outcomes, highlighting the effectiveness of shared goals and mutual support.

Sober Living Houses: A Supportive Environment

Explore the Supportive Environment of Sober Living Houses!

Importance of sober living houses

Sober living houses (SLHs) provide crucial support for individuals seeking recovery from substance use disorders. These residences create a safe, alcohol- and drug-free environment where residents can focus on their recovery without the distractions or temptations of their past. The community nature of SLHs fosters a sense of accountability, with residents encouraged to adhere to house rules and support one another in their sobriety journey.

Structure and benefits

SLHs typically emphasize a supportive structure, often requiring participation in 12-step programs or group meetings. The average length of stay in these recovery-focused environments is over 90 days, facilitating deeper engagement in the recovery process. Benefits include:

Benefit Description Outcome
Improved Social Connections Residents build relationships with peers facing similar challenges. Strengthened support network and shared experiences.
Structured Living Environment Encourages routine, responsibility, and personal growth. Enhanced life skills and self-discipline.
Increased Recovery Outcomes Studies show improvements in abstinence rates and reduced arrests. Sustainable recovery and reduced risk of relapse.

Overall, sober living houses serve as a vital part of the recovery continuum, helping individuals reclaim their lives and thrive in sobriety.

Overcoming Triggers and Emotional Challenges

Identifying Triggers to Prevent Relapse

Recognizing personal triggers is an essential step in maintaining sobriety. These triggers can manifest as:

  • External Triggers: People, places, or events associated with past substance use.
  • Internal Triggers: Emotions, negative thoughts, or stressors that led to substance use in the past.

By identifying these factors, individuals can avoid high-risk situations that may provoke cravings, which can significantly raise the risk of relapse.

Coping Mechanisms and Support

Developing effective coping mechanisms is vital for navigating emotional challenges. Some strategies include:

  1. Healthy Activities: Engaging in exercise, meditation, or hobbies can provide positive outlets for stress.
  2. Support Groups: Joining communities such as Alcoholics Anonymous (AA) or Narcotics Anonymous (NA) offers emotional support and a shared recovery experience.
  3. Professional Help: Seeking guidance from therapists can help devise personalized strategies to handle triggers effectively.
  4. Structured Scheduling: Creating a daily routine can minimize idle time, leaving less opportunity for temptation.

Implementing these coping strategies and recognizing triggers not only empowers individuals to sustain their sobriety but also promotes long-term emotional well-being.
